Background. Women experience drastic hormonal changes during midlife due to the menopausal transition. Menopausal hormonal changes are known to lead to bone loss and potentially also to loss of lean mass. The loss of muscle and bone tissue coincide due to the functional relationship and interaction between these tissues. If and how physical activity counteracts deterioration in muscle and bone during the menopausal transition remains partly unresolved. The need for more rapid onset of action and improved absorption of medications has resulted in great development of drug delivery technologies. Transmucosal drug delivery offers a convenient route of administration for a variety of clinical indications. Unfortunately, the wide variability in structure of the oral mucosal tissues could constitute a key factor in drug penetration and absorption. To circumvent this obstacle and to increase the drug flux through the mucosal membranes, different approaches to permeation enhancement are used. The continuing decline of many natural plant and animal populations emphasizes the importance of conservation strategies. Hybridization as a management tool has proven successful in introducing gene flow to small, inbred populations, but can be also associated with health risks. For example, hybridization can change susceptibility to infection in either direction due to heterosis (hybrid vigor) and outbreeding depression, but such health effects have rarely been considered in the genetic management of populations.
